2026-08-17 · Releases: containerd · source ↗ #containerd#container-runtime#patch-release
  • Platform/SRE — Plan: Despite being a patch release, 2.3.4 ships a breaking change: checkpoint restore in CreateContainer is now disabled by default, requiring an explicit config opt-in. Also fixes a memory leak in the OOM watcher and binary protobuf shim corruption. Review workloads using CRIU/checkpoint restore before upgrading; schedule the upgrade this quarter.

2026-08-10 · Releases: moby · source ↗ #docker#container-runtime#patch-release
  • Platform/SRE — Plan: Two regressions introduced in 29.7.0 — image pulls rejecting hardlink targets and file-permission failures on older kernels — are fixed in 29.7.2; if you upgraded to 29.7.x recently, schedule a patch to 29.7.2 to restore stable image pull behavior.
